@font-face{font-family:cooper-black-std,serif;font-weight:400;font-style:normal}@font-face{font-family:cooper-black-std,serif;font-weight:400;font-style:italic}*{font-family:cooper-black-std!important}.tbc-header-inner{display:flex;flex-direction:column;max-width:1080px;margin:0 auto;gap:2rem;padding:2rem}.tbc-header-upper-wrapper{display:flex;align-items:center;justify-content:space-between}.tbc-header-menu-wrapper>a{font-size:2.5rem;color:#555c3e;text-decoration:none;text-transform:lowercase}.tbc-header-menu-bullet{font-size:2rem;color:#555c3e}.tbc-social-icons>li>a{font-size:2.5rem;color:#555c3e;padding:.5rem}.tbc-social-icons>li>a>svg{height:2.75rem!important;width:2.75rem!important}.tbc-header-lower-wrapper{display:flex;align-items:center;justify-content:center}img.tbc-header-logo{width:100%}.tbc-header-mobile-trigger-wrapper,.tbc-mobile-menu-container{display:none}@media only screen and (max-width: 900px){.tbc-header-upper-wrapper{display:none}.tbc-header-lower-wrapper{display:flex;align-items:center;justify-content:space-between}.tbc-header-logo-wrapper{display:flex;flex:.8;padding-top:4px}.tbc-header-mobile-trigger-wrapper{display:flex;flex:.2;justify-content:flex-end}#tbc-mobile-menu-trigger:hover,#tbc-mobile-menu-close:hover{cursor:pointer}#tbc-mobile-menu-close{position:absolute;top:27px;right:38px;fill:#f9f4e1}.tbc-mobile-menu-container{position:fixed;display:none;opacity:0;top:0;right:0;left:0;bottom:0;height:100vh;width:100vw;background:#1b7b97;align-items:center;justify-content:center;transition:all .25s ease-in-out}.tbc-mobile-menu-links-wrapper{display:flex;flex-direction:column;justify-content:center;align-items:center}.tbc-mobile-menu-links-wrapper>a{color:#f9f4e1;text-decoration:none;font-size:2.5rem}.tbc-social-icons{margin-top:2rem}.tbc-social-icons>li>a{font-size:2.5rem;color:#f9f4e1;padding:.5rem}}.footer *{color:#f9f4e1!important}.footer{border-top:0px!important;margin-top:2rem}footer{background:transparent!important;position:relative;padding-bottom:0!important}footer *{color:#f9f4e1!important}.footer__content-top{position:relative;max-width:none}.footer__content-bottom{background:#0183a9;padding-bottom:36px!important;border-top:0!important;color:#f9f4e1!important}footer a{text-decoration:none!important;color:#f9f4e1!important}.footer-block__heading{color:#f9f4e1;margin-bottom:0!important;padding-left:.35rem}.field__input{background:transparent!important;border:2px solid #F9F4E1;border-left:0px;border-right:0px;border-top:0px;color:#545c3e!important;padding:1.5rem}.field__label,.field__button{color:#f9f4e1}.field__label{left:.5rem}.field:before,.field:after{box-shadow:none!important}.footer__content-top{display:flex!important;gap:5rem;background-image:url(https://bavibeats.myshopify.com/cdn/shop/files/footer-bg.png);background-size:cover;background-repeat:no-repeat;background-position:left top;justify-content:flex-end;padding-top:10%;padding-bottom:0!important}.footer__blocks-wrapper{width:40%}.footer-block--newsletter{display:flex!important;flex-direction:column;width:20%;margin-top:0!important;align-items:start!important}.link.list-social__link{padding-left:0rem}.footer__content-bottom-wrapper{margin:0 auto;text-align:center!important;justify-content:center;align-items:center}@media only screen and (min-width: 1000px) and (max-width: 1200px){.footer__content-top{padding-top:15%}}@media only screen and (min-width: 800px) and (max-width: 999px){.footer__content-top{padding-top:25%}.footer-block__details-content .list-menu__item--link{padding-top:0rem!important;padding-bottom:0rem!important}}@media (max-width: 800px){.footer-block__details-content{margin-bottom:1rem!important}.footer-block.grid__item{margin:1rem 0!important}.footer__content-top{background:#0183a9!important;background-image:none}.footer__content-top{display:flex;flex-direction:column;justify-content:center;text-align:center;gap:0rem}.footer-block.grid__item,.footer-block__details-content{margin:.5rem 0rem}.footer-block.grid__item{border-bottom:1px solid rgba(255,255,255,.25)}.list-menu__item--link{padding:.25rem 0rem!important;font-size:12px}.footer__blocks-wrapper{width:100%}.footer-block--newsletter{width:100%;margin:0 auto;display:flex;align-items:center;justify-content:center}.footer-block__newsletter:not(:only-child){text-align:center;margin:0 auto;margin-top:2rem}.list-social{margin:0 auto}}.tbc-layout-wrapper{display:flex;flex-direction:row;justify-content:center;max-width:1080px;margin:0 auto;column-gap:1rem}.tbc-left-column,.tbc-right-column{width:50%}.tbc-left-column{display:flex;flex-direction:column}.tbc-right-column{margin-top:.5rem}.tbc-layout-row{display:flex}.tbc-shapes-wrapper{width:40%}.tbc-image-wrapper{width:60%}.tbc-shapes-image{width:100%}.tbc-row-image{width:100%;padding:5px}.tbc-shop-link-wrapper{width:60%;margin:.5rem 1rem 1rem 0rem;position:relative}.tbc-shop-link-content{position:relative;z-index:1;display:flex!important;flex-direction:column!important;justify-content:center;align-items:center;padding:0rem;margin-top:1.25rem}.tbc-shop-link-content>img{width:75%}.tbc-shop-link-button{text-decoration:none;color:#f9f4e1;font-size:2.5rem;background:#1b7b97;padding:0 3.5rem;transform:perspective(800px) rotateY(15deg);letter-spacing:2px;margin-top:0rem;transition:all .25s ease-in-out}.tbc-shop-link-button:hover{cursor:pointer;transform:scale(1.05) perspective(800px) rotateY(15deg)}.tbc-shop-link-background{display:flex!important;top:0;left:0;z-index:0;width:100%;height:100%;position:absolute;background:#fff9b4;transform:perspective(800px) rotateY(-10deg)}.tbc-tour-dates-wrapper{background:#1b7b97;padding:2.5rem}.tbc-tour-dates-wrapper h3{color:#f9f4e1;font-size:3rem;margin:0px 0px 1rem}@media only screen and (max-width: 900px){.tbc-tour-dates-wrapper h3{text-align:center}.tbc-layout-row.two,.tbc-layout-row.three{display:none}.tbc-layout-wrapper{flex-direction:column}.tbc-left-column,.tbc-right-column{width:100%;padding:1rem}}.bit-widget .bit-follow-section-wrapper,.bit-nav-bar{display:none!important}.bit-widget{background:transparent!important;color:#f9f4e1!important}a.bit-event{display:flex;flex-direction:row!important}.bit-widget .bit-event{border-top:0px!important;color:#f9f4e1!important}.bit-widget .bit-upcoming-events{margin:0!important}.bit-event{padding:8px 0 6px!important;border:0px}.bit-event.bit-details,.bit-event,.bit-details{align-items:start!important}.bit-rsvp.bit-button{display:none!important}a.bit-event *{font-size:13px!important;text-align:left;font-weight:400;line-height:1.25}.bit-mobile-date-and-share-wrapper{flex:.3;justify-content:start!important}.bit-details-inner-wrapper-vertical-date{flex:.6}.bit-details.bit-event-buttons{flex:.05;margin:0!important}.bit-widget .bit-offers{width:auto!important;background:#555c3e!important;padding:1rem!important;border-radius:0!important;color:#f9f4e1!important}.bit-offers-text{color:#f9f4e1!important}.bit-details.bit-event-buttons a{color:#6695e2!important}.bit-rsvp-container,.bit-event .bit-offers-container{margin:0!important}.bit-offers-inner-wrapper{text-align:right!important;margin-right:0!important}.bit-play-my-city-wrapper{display:none!important}.bit-widget .bit-upcoming-events,bit-past-events{border-bottom:0px!important}.bit-upcoming-events-show-all-button{display:none}.bit-widget.bit-layout-desktop .bit-vertical-date-numeric-date{line-height:initial!important}.bit-mobile-date-and-share-wrapper{display:none!important}.bit-vertical-date{display:flex!important;flex-direction:row!important;gap:.5rem;justify-content:flex-start!important;align-items:center!important;flex:.35}.bit-widget .bit-vertical-date{border:0px!important;padding:0 5px}a.bit-mobile-date{font-size:2rem!important;margin-top:1rem}.tbc-view-all-dates-button-wrapper{display:flex;margin:0 auto}.tbc-view-all-dates-button-wrapper>a{background:#555c3e!important;color:#f9f4e1!important;border:none!important;border-radius:0!important;max-width:200px;width:200px;margin:0 auto!important;margin-top:2rem!important;transition:all .25s ease-in-out;text-align:center;padding:1rem}.tbc-view-all-dates-button-wrapper>a{color:#f9f4e1!important;text-decoration:none}.tbc-view-all-dates-button-wrapper>a:hover{transform:scale(1.05);cursor:pointer}@media (max-width: 950px){a.bit-event *{text-align:center!important;width:100%}a.bit-event{flex-direction:column!important;gap:1rem;align-items:center!important;justify-content:center}.bit-vertical-date{display:none!important}.bit-mobile-date-and-share-wrapper{display:flex!important}}.page-width.page-width--narrow.section-template--22666515349791__main-padding{display:none}#shopify-section-template--22658756509983__form .button{color:#f9f4e1!important}
/*# sourceMappingURL=/cdn/shop/t/3/assets/custom.css.map */
